Cybersecurity researchers at the Georgia Institute of Technology have helped close a security vulnerability which could have allowed hackers to steal encryption keys from a popular security bundle by temporarily listening in on unintended"side channel" signals from smartphones.

The attack, which was reported to applications developers before it was publicized, took advantage of programming that has been, ironically, designed to provide better security. The assault utilized intercepted electromagnetic signals in the phones that might have been analyzed using a small mobile device costing less than a thousand dollars. Unlike earlier intercept attempts that demanded analyzing many logins, the"One & Done" assault was carried out by eavesdropping on just one decryption cycle. .

"This is something that can be done at an airport to steal people's information without arousing suspicion and makes the so-called'coffee shop strike' much more realistic," said Milos Prvulovic, associate chair of Georgia Tech's School of Computer Science. "The designers of encryption software now have another problem they need to take into account because continuous snooping long periods of time will no longer be asked to steal this information." .

The side channel attack is believed to be the first to retrieve the key exponent of an encryption key in a modern version of OpenSSL without relying on the cache organization and/or timing. OpenSSL is a popular encryption program used for try this website protected interactions on sites and for signature authentication. The attack revealed that a single recording of a cryptography key trace was sufficient to violate 2048 pieces of a private RSA key. .

Results of the study, that was encouraged in part by the National Science Foundation, the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A), and the Air Force Research Laboratory (AFRL) will be presented in the 27th USENIX Security Symposium August 16th in Baltimore.

After successfully attacking the phones and an embedded system board -- which all used ARM processors -- the researchers proposed a fix for the vulnerability, which had been embraced in versions of this applications made available in May.

Side channel attacks extract sensitive information in signals made by electronic action within computing apparatus during normal operation. The signals include electromagnetic emanations made by current flows within the apparatus computational and power-delivery circuitry, variation in electricity consumption, and also sound, temperature and chassis potential variation. These emanations are extremely different from communications signals the devices are designed to produce. .

In their demonstration, Prvulovic and collaborator Alenka Zajic listened in on two different Android phones using probes located near, but not touching the devices. In a real attack, signals could be obtained from phones or other mobile devices by antennas Visit Website found beneath tables or hidden in nearby furniture.

The"One & Done" attack analyzed signals in a comparatively narrow (40 MHz wide) band around the phones' processor clock frequencies, which are near to 1 GHz (1,000 MHz). The investigators took advantage of a uniformity in programming which had been designed to overcome earlier vulnerabilities involving variations in how go to this web-site the programs operate. .
